diff --git a/docker-compose.frontend.yml b/docker-compose.frontend.yml index 9b80454..c1077ce 100644 --- a/docker-compose.frontend.yml +++ b/docker-compose.frontend.yml @@ -2,8 +2,10 @@ services: frontend: build: context: ./frontend + args: + NEXT_PUBLIC_BACKEND_URL: ${NEXT_PUBLIC_BACKEND_URL:-https://backend.basetracker.lona-development.org} environment: - NEXT_PUBLIC_BACKEND_URL: https://backend.basetracker.lona-development.org + NEXT_PUBLIC_BACKEND_URL: ${NEXT_PUBLIC_BACKEND_URL:-https://backend.basetracker.lona-development.org} ports: - "3100:3000" expose: diff --git a/frontend/Dockerfile b/frontend/Dockerfile index e8e32ca..abcd5c0 100644 --- a/frontend/Dockerfile +++ b/frontend/Dockerfile @@ -2,6 +2,9 @@ FROM node:20-alpine WORKDIR /app +ARG NEXT_PUBLIC_BACKEND_URL="http://localhost:4100" +ENV NEXT_PUBLIC_BACKEND_URL=${NEXT_PUBLIC_BACKEND_URL} + COPY package.json ./ COPY tsconfig.json ./ COPY next.config.js ./